An insurer may not agree with any other insurer to adhere to or use any rate or supplementary rate information. The fact that an insurer adheres to or uses such material is not sufficient in itself to support a finding that an agreement to adhere or use exists, but such fact may supplement other evidence of such agreement. Two (2) or more insurers having common ownership or operating in this state under common management or control may act in concert between or among themselves in the same manner as if they constitute a single insurer.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Mississippi Code Title 83. Insurance § 83-2-21 -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ms/title-83-insurance/ms-code-sect-83-2-21/
